Netflix is partnering with Korean manufacturer LG Electronics to stream movies and other programming to LG's high-definition televisions. Reed Hastings, CEO of Netflix, says he hopes to strike other such deals and that Netflix would soon be viewed as a movie channel that might appear on myriad devices. The move could help transform Netflix from a successful company with a cumbersome dependence on physical media and the Postal Service into an important player in a rapidly emerging digital media landscape. As Dell broadens from just selling its wares directly over the Internet and by phone, it risks siphoning off its base of Web customers. So it is carefully choosing which retailers to link up with and then cherry-picking which products to sell in each store. Best Buy is offering Dell's desktop computers, its more expensive 14-inch Inspiron laptops, and its high-end XPS branded notebooks. But Best Buy isn't offering Dell's printers or its lower-end notebooks. The nature of the corporate naming rights deals for stadiums and arenas has evolved dramatically, experts say. The name on the outside of the building is now just a small part of the deal, with companies receiving luxury suites, networking opportunities, access to players and product placement. According to Revenues From Sports Venues, a Nashville-based company that tracks how stadiums and arenas make money, there have been 19 deals of $100 million or more over the past decade or so. Ford has entered into "focused negotiations at a more detailed level" with India's Tata Motors, meaning Tata has become the preferred bidder for its Jaguar and Land Rover units. "We will proceed with further substantive discussions with Tata Motors over the forthcoming weeks," says Lewis Booth, executive vice president of Ford's European units, in a statement. Jaguar and Land Rover employees in the United Kingdom were told about the negotiations this morning shortly before the company made the announcement. Steve and Barry's, the 265-store casual sportswear chain, is set to launch a surf and skate line by surfer Laird Hamilton. The collection includes graphic T-shirts, board shorts and casual clothing for men who embrace the surf and skate lifestyle. The chain has been pairing with celebrities from actress Sarah Jessica Parker to National Basketball Association player Stephon Marbury for nearly 18 months. Each star launches their own exclusive Steve and Barry's product line and makes national in-store appearances to pitch their wares, as well as the brand.
